Latest Patents

Wei-Ming Wu's latest patents include a method for screening samples for building a prediction model and a computer program product thereof. This invention provides a systematic approach to managing sample data within a dynamic moving window. It involves clustering sample data with similar properties and determining whether to retain or delete data based on predetermined thresholds.

Another significant patent is the advanced process control system and method utilizing virtual metrology with a reliance index. This invention incorporates virtual metrology into advanced process control, using a reliance index to gauge the reliability of virtual measurements. It adjusts controller gains based on the similarity of process data, enhancing the accuracy of predictions in manufacturing processes.
